Full Job Description
Job Description:


Description:

The Internal Sales Consultant will partner with their assigned Regional Sales Consultant (RSC) to drive new business opportunities and manage financial intermediary relationships within a geographic territory. You will be responsible for delivering a high level of service and for proactively meeting territory needs in a timely fashion.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and execute strategic business plan with assigned RSC’s to achieve territory sales goals and grow market share
  • Assist with scheduling RSC appointments and events
  • Maintain CRM and proposal systems for assigned territory and ISC back up assignment
  • Actively engage with financial intermediaries to uncover needs, provide solutions, advance the sale, and define next steps in relation to promoting and uncovering new retirement plan sales opportunities
  • Prepare and follow-up on request for illustrations and proposals, coordinate pre-and post-sales deliverables, and manage the frequency & consistency of territory support
  • Raise awareness of TRA’s products and services by delivering key messages through targeted prospecting or campaign activities; including cold calls and virtual communications
  • Build, grow and maintain financial intermediary relationships by developing a thorough understanding of the financial service industry, marketplace and TRA’s value added offerings and successfully positions TRA’s products and services
  • Develops a thorough understanding of the sales process and utilizes it to advance sales
  • Assesses the needs of each prospect by asking targeted, high impact questions and positions the appropriate product and/or service that meet those needs
  • Actively engage in plan design, retention, consulting and restoration opportunities
  • Actively engage in TRA education and development programs
  • Maintain current knowledge of industry and legislative updates
  • Outstanding TRA Corporate Citizen dedicated to maintaining TRA’s reputation always in the communities we touch
  • Other responsibilities as assigned


Required Experience:


Qualifications:

  • Undergraduate degree or equivalent experience
  • Strong pension and investment knowledge
  • Must obtain ASPPA RPF1 & RPF2 examinations within one year of hire
  • Must obtain Kravitz Cash Balance Coach Program certification within six months of hire
  • High energy, motivated individual, committed to excellence.
  • Understanding of and passion for the sales process with a positive mindset
  • Demonstrated professional presence, poise and presentation skills
  • Excellent verbal and written communications skills.
  • Excellent organizational and follow up skills. Ability to handle multiple responsibilities simultaneously.
  • Good working knowledge of PC and MS software. Understanding of CRM systems.
  • Ability to travel (5% of time)
